98 Oxford Street, Northampton, NN4 8HE is a freehold terraced property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 958 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have three b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£244,524 , which equates to approximately £255 per square foot. It was last sold on 21 Dec 2017 for £190,000. Since then, the value has increased by £54,524, representing a 28.7% increase, or approximately 3.6% per year.

The current estimated value of £244,524 is:

  • 13.6% higher than the average property price on Oxford Street
  • 13.5% higher than the average in the NN4 8HE postcode area
  • and 11.6% lower than the average price for Northampton as a whole

Based on EPC inspection history, this property has been mostly owner-occupied (2 out of 3 inspections). This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 27 January 2025, the property was recorded as rented.

98 Oxford Street, Northampton, Northamptonshire, NN4 8HE has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 27 Jan 2025.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 21 Feb 2022, when the property was rated D. Since then, the rating has improved to C,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 7.6%.
